The Position
Are you passionate about leading innovative engineering projects and elevating product quality and robustness? We are seeking a Senior Staff Process Engineer to join our dynamic team, where you will spearhead critical process engineering investigations, identify failure modes, and implement cutting-edge methods to enhance our ePlex products.
In this role, you will drive process development, characterization, and improvement activities for both new and existing product lines. Your expertise will be vital in designing and implementing new automation equipment, assessing production for quality enhancements, and validating new or improved processes and manufacturing equipment. You will work with advanced processes including surface treatment, precision dispensing of fluids and adhesives, and other sophisticated material sciences technologies such as plasma treatment, CO2 cleaning processes, and laser bonding.
Your strong communication skills will enable you to interact effectively with key decision-makers across various departments, including quality assurance, research and development, and manufacturing. The Opportunity
Continuously improve production processes in manufacturing
Lead project teams as part of product improvements, automation, and quality improvements
Troubleshoot issues that arise within the manufacturing process
Lead or participate in teams to identify critical product or process attributes and parameters, design studies to characterize parameters (DOE), and evaluate risks and mitigations (pFMEAs/dFMEAs)
Apply standard project management tools and principles to ensure project success
Serve as advocate and role model for integrating change into the organization as well as serve as departmental role model of professional behavior and presence.
Lead change control activities within cross functional departments
Create and approve Product BOM’s, Specs, Work Instructions and other documentation as part of the Design Transfer for new product introductions.
Follow cGMP and ISO standards
Who you are
Bachelors in Engineering, 15+ years related experience or MS degree in Engineering and 10+ years related experience depending on level, background and industry.
Experience in designing/implementing manufacturing processes, equipment and fixtures.
Project Management successes with expertise influencing key decision makers within a matrix environment.
Strong quality-orientation with attention to detail and a desire to deliver service excellence is essential.
Strong influencing and interpersonal skills and the ability to work well with others in a proactive, positive and constructive manner.
Working knowledge of pharmaceutical/medical device cGMPs and FDA compliance is strongly preferred.
Proficient using SolidWorks preferred.
Experience with design transfer activities for medical devices is a plus.
Experience designing/implementing automation equipment is a plus.
Chemical – Familiarity with multi-step organic chemical purification is a plus.
Material Science knowledge is a plus.
Experience with surface treatment (i.e. plasma, CO2 cleaning), laser bonding and dispensing is a plus.
